"The Bull Bar & Grill is the latest 14th Street NW venture from Latin restaurateur and fellow Columbia Heights native Aldo Cruz. The Bull, located a few blocks north, can fit 75 patrons inside and another 30 across its front and back patios. His teammate at The Bull is also chef Omar Marroquin, whose opening 'Triple-Double Overtime' cheeseburger will star a whole pound of meat between a bun." - Tierney Plumb

I was here for an event earlier, but my friend and I had the genius idea of staying after and having dinner! Definitely a great decision. We got a table for 4, and I got to try one of their margaritas, mozzarella sticks and sliders! I have zero complaints about the passion fruit marg I had... it was just perfect. The mozz sticks and the marinara sauce were excellent... great amount of cheese, great breading, great flavors. The grilled chicken sliders had everything you'd want -- avocados, jalapenos, cheese... now, certain bites of the bottom bun felt a little chewy/stiff... miiiight've been a little stale? But could've been the toasting, who knows. But it wasn't enough to take away from the excellence of the sliders. This was an opportunity to really take in the interior of the place. I found out about their happy hour that's Monday - Friday 3-8, with $5 rails, $3 beers, $10 chicken melt & fries and some other things. They also have a bottomless brunch that I MUST come back and try. The service was awesome as we ate and drank, and the staff continued to be super friendly. The awesome music didn't stop either. This place has only been around for about 3 months... I hope they continue to do well!
